Usando MBP como servidor web con muchos usuarios

2

Enseño clases de nuevos medios en una pequeña universidad de artes y ciencias liberales. Durante los últimos años, he estado ejecutando un servidor Ubuntu en una PC de escritorio vieja en mi oficina. Al comienzo de cada semestre, creo una cuenta en el servidor web para cada estudiante. Aprenden cómo usar FTP para cargar sus proyectos digitales, y algunos estudiantes experimentan con las opciones básicas de la línea de comandos de UNIX. El servidor murió recientemente, y me encantaría cambiar mi viejo Macbook como el nuevo servidor.

He pasado la mayor parte del día intentando instalar Ubuntu 14.04 en un MBP de finales de 2011. Desafortunadamente, la configuración de la tarjeta gráfica dual causa problemas reales para el instalador de Ubuntu. He trabajado en varias guías de instalación y no puedo administrar para iniciar el sistema operativo Ubuntu sin editar manualmente el grub cada vez.

¿Es posible lograr mis objetivos mientras me mantengo con Yosemite en el MBP? Específicamente, esto es lo que necesito para poder hacer:

  • SSH en el servidor MBP desde mi otra computadora para crear nuevas cuentas de usuario.

  • Permita que los estudiantes se conecten a sus carpetas FTP a través de SFTP. En el transcurso de un año típico, probablemente se crearán alrededor de 30 nuevas cuentas de usuario.

En serio ... Eso es todo lo que tengo que hacer. No necesito una interfaz gráfica elegante. Solo quiero hacer telnet / FTP en el servidor y, ocasionalmente, instalarlo para recibir las últimas actualizaciones de seguridad.

Sé que las Mac tienen algún tipo de terminal UNIX bajo el shell. Sería genial si pudiera solo telnet / SSH para llegar a la máquina desde mi computadora de escritorio. Entonces, podría usar comandos básicos de UNIX para crear cuentas de usuario.

    
pregunta Aaron Delwiche 06.12.2015 - 02:34

1 respuesta

0

Estoy seguro de que puede crear usuarios manualmente desde la línea de comandos en OS X, y aunque tengo un gran fondo de * nix, solo estoy familiarizado con este enfoque desde el punto de vista de la GUI en OS X (aunque como dije, esto no significa que no se pueda hacer.

Simplemente ingrese a la consola o habilite la administración remota para su usuario de OS X y VNC a la Mac desde su escritorio. O instale xRDP en la Mac, que es mi preferencia personal para el acceso GUI de Windows a Mac.

Desde allí, solo ve a Preferencias del sistema y crea las cuentas de usuario desde allí. Puede modificar el acceso de administración remota para permitir a estos usuarios o agregarlos a un grupo específico y otorgarle a ese grupo acceso SSH desde allí.

Esto logrará lo que buscas lograr. Si los comandos básicos son los mismos con los que está familiarizado, simplemente habilite la Administración remota, SSH para Mac y haga lo suyo desde la línea de comandos.

    
respondido por el rubynorails 06.12.2015 - 03:44

Lea otras preguntas en las etiquetas